In 2020 Mexico introduced black seals on labels that alert consumers about excess sugar, calories, sodium, and other potentially harmful ingredients as part of its efforts to improve the health of the nation and to tackle the obesity epidemic. Following on from this, the most recent regulation on food products has led to restrictions on the advertising of products to children that have these black seals.
